Stem cell therapy holds tremendous promise for treating a wide range of physical conditions. However, accessing this potentially life-changing treatment can be costly. The expenses associated with stem cell therapy can vary vastly depending on factors such as the type of cells, the intensity of the condition, and the region of the treatment.
Several patients seeking stem cell therapy face financial challenges. It is important to meticulously research and evaluate different treatment options and providers to understand the overall cost necessary.
Several factors can influence the expense of stem cell therapy. These include:
* The sophistication of the procedure itself.
* The quantity of stem cells required.
* The timeframe of the treatment process.
* Potential issues that may arise during or after treatment.
Potential financing options, such as payment plans, should also be explored to ease the financial burden of stem cell therapy.

Stem Cell Injections: A Breakthrough in Knee Repair?
Knee pain is a common ailment that can significantly impact quality of life. Traditional treatments like physical therapy and pain medication often provide only temporary relief. A new frontier in medicine has shown promising results for stem cell injections as a potential solution for knee injuries. Stem cells are special cells that have the ability to mature into different types of tissues, offering the possibility of repairing damaged cartilage and restoring healthy joint tissue.
- Preliminary studies suggest that stem cell injections can significantly lessen pain and improve knee function in patients with osteoarthritis, a degenerative condition that damages the cartilage.
- Physicians are cautiously optimistic about the promise of stem cell therapy for knee repair.
- Further investigation is needed to determine the long-term effectiveness and safety of this treatment, but early results suggest a transformative solution in knee care.
